  1. General

    The Campus Card is the official identification card of Midwestern State University and may be used for a variety of campus access options and may be used as an optional ATM/Debit Card. The Campus Care is available to faculty and staff in accordance with the following procedures.
      1. Faculty/Staff


      2. All full-time, benefit-eligible employees of Midwestern State University are eligible for a Campus Card. The Campus Card is a permanent card and requires no validation. Campus Cards areissued in the Campus Card Services Office. A letter of verification of employment from the Human Resources Department and a government-issued photo ID are required prior to issuing of a Campus Card. The letter is to include the employee's name and social security number.
        When a faculty or staff member terminates employment with the university, the Campus Card Will be returned to the Human Resources Department.

      4. Retired Faculty/Staff

    A new I.D. card is issued when a faculty or staff member retires from MSU. These individuals are eligible for the same privileges as regular employees.
  2. Lost or Stolen Campus Cards
      1. Lost or stolen cards must be immediately reported to the Campus Card Services Office. Suspended
        cardsmust be presented to the Campus Card Services Office for reactivation during strated office hours.
